1. A communication system comprising:

  • a first base station;

    one or more second base stations; and

    a terminal,the first base station includesa receiver that receives information about reception time, at which the terminal receives information sent from the first base station by using a first frequency band and receives information sent from the first base station or the one or more second base stations by using one or more second frequency bands or transmission time, at which the first base station sends information by using the first frequency band, and the first base station or the one or more second base stations send information by using one or more second frequency bands,a selector that selects from among the one or more second frequency bands, based on information about the reception time or the transmission time received by the receiver, the second frequency bands that are simultaneously used with the first frequency band by the terminal, anda first controller that performs control about the selected second frequency bands, andthe terminal includesa second controller that performs control, in accordance with the control performed by the first base station, such that communication is performed by simultaneously using the first frequency band and selected second frequency bands,the terminal complies with a control signal that is generated based on a propagation delay difference between first propagation delay and second propagation delay in the first base station to perform communication by using a plurality of cells in which uplink transmission timing and downlink reception timing do not overlap with each other.
